Begin by surveying your chosen site. Ensure the ground is level and can support the weight of the fully loaded plant. For a stationary model, you will need to pour concrete foundations for each main component (mixer, aggregate bins, cement silo). The YG team should provide detailed site drawings based on your order. Crane lifting is typically required for placing the mixer unit and main frame. Once positioned, connect the hydraulic lines, electrical cables, and conveyor sections according to the assembly manual. This step can take several days to a week depending on the crew size. If you are evaluating a ready mix concrete mixing line vs alternatives, the installation time is a factor to consider.
After physical assembly, power up the centralized control system. Before loading any materials, run a dry cycle to check all moving parts and sensor feedback. Calibrate the weighing systems using certified test weights. The control interface will walk you through setting mix recipes, which involves entering the target weight for cement, aggregates, water, and admixtures. Run a trial batch with a dry aggregate mix first to confirm the batching sequence works correctly.
Daily operation involves loading aggregate bins, filling the cement silo, and selecting a recipe on the control panel. Start the mixing cycle, which automatically weights, conveys, and mixes the ingredients. For a ready mix concrete mixing line, the discharge cycle transfers the mixed concrete into a truck mixer. Monitor the cycle times and mix consistency through the central display. The system is designed for high-volume production, so you can run multiple batches per hour.
Pro users can optimize their operations by adjusting the mixing time based on specific aggregate sizes or using the system’s data logging to track material consumption and batch history. Programming multiple recipes in advance allows for quick switching between different concrete strengths. You can also set up alarms for low material levels to prevent downtime. Daily maintenance includes cleaning the mixer drum to prevent concrete build-up. Check hydraulic fluid levels and inspect hoses for wear. Lubricate the conveyor bearings and weigh hopper pivots weekly. Every 500 hours of operation, perform a full inspection of the hydraulic system and replace filters. Follow the manufacturer’s schedule for replacing mixer blades and liners. Proper maintenance is critical to making the concrete batching plant worth buying over the long term.
If the system fails to start, check emergency stop buttons and power supply connections. Inconsistent batching accuracy often indicates a need for recalibration of weighing sensors or a stuck hopper gate. Low hydraulic pressure usually points to a fluid or pump issue. For software errors, the control system logs error codes you can look up in the manual. Contact YG technical support for complex electrical or programming problems.

Do not skimp on the concrete base for the plant. A poorly leveled foundation will cause misalignment of conveyors and mixers, leading to excessive wear and downtime.
Maintain batching accuracy by recalibrating the scales every week. This simple practice prevents costly mix errors and ensures your concrete meets specification.
Prevent concrete build-up in the mixer drum by using a specialized concrete remover. Standard cleaning takes too long and can damage the drum surface. You can find these agents at concrete batching plant worth buying accessories.
Pre-program your most common mix designs into the control system. This reduces cycle time and minimizes operator input errors when switching between batches.
Hydraulic fluid is the lifeblood of this system. Change it every 1000 hours of operation to prevent pump failure and maintain consistent torque.
Cross-train your crew so that the plant can continue operating if one operator is absent. The centralized control system makes training relatively quick.
Analyze the batch history logs to track material usage and production efficiency. This data can help you negotiate better bulk prices from suppliers.
